Weekend Woman's Hour: Lena Headey, Women in Iran, Dr Emma Chapman, Hysteroscopy and pain relief, Para-athlete Melanie Woods

Actor, writer and director Lena Headey is best known for playing Cersei Lannister in Game of Thrones. She has created and stars in Intimacy, a new BBC Sounds audio drama and podcast which follows intimacy coordinator Liza Simmons, whose professional life revolves around creating safe spaces and navigating consent on film sets. When a dream job on a big movie production takes her to a Greek island, long-buried secrets resurface and force her to confront a troubled past. Lena talks about this new series and life after Game of Thrones.

As the US and Iran continue exchanging fire, Anita Rani talks to global affairs journalist Tara Kangarlou and researcher at King's College London Dr Ahou Koutchesfahani to ask how life for women in the country has changed since the war.

How can we explore distant stars, buried water on Mars, or witness the first moments after the Big Bang? And what can we see without having to leave our back garden? Dr Emma Chapman an award-winning radio astronomer based at the University of Nottingham, and a Royal Society Dorothy Hodgkin research fellow, is joined by Clare McDonnell to discuss the radio universe, the upcoming Perseid Meteor Shower and a partial solar eclipse.

Could using conscious sedation transform the experience of hysteroscopy? Around 70,000 women undergo this womb procedure every year, but campaigners say many are still left in severe pain with too few options for pain relief. Clare talked to Dawn Lord who says her hysteroscopy left her traumatised, and to Irina Stankeviciute, a hysteroscopy nurse who has helped pioneer a new conscious sedation service aimed at giving women more choice and control.

The Commonwealth Games began this week in Glasgow, and Clare was joined by wheelchair racer Melanie Woods who will be competing.
